Lahore, Thursday, March 4, 1915

Indian soldiers in France and Belgium



AT Tuesday's meeting of the Imperial Legislative Council the Hon. Raja Jai Chand requested the issue of a list specifying the regimental numbers assigned to those Indian soldiers in France and Belgium who are reported to be missing and asked whether the existing regulations for the grant of pensions to widows and children of Indian soldiers killed in the battlefield applied also to soldiers who were reported to be missing. In reply his Excellency the Commander-In-Chief said: - "List of Indian soldiers reported to be missing are sent to deposits for communication to the families concerned. In view of the liability to changes in reports I do not consider it desirable to publish the list suggested by Hon'ble Raja Jai Chand. Under section 136, Chapters VII to XVI, Field Service Regulations, and a special Indian Army order issued by moon the 4th December a court of enquiry is held whenever officers and soldiers are reported missing to collect all evidence of the circumstance of each case.
